Sida 1 av 1
får permission denied när jag ska logga in via ssh
Postat: 01 maj 2012, 13:01
av zimzon
Hejsan,
Har nyligen installerat ubuntu 12.04 server och kört in openssh-server på burken.
när jag nu försöker logga in får jag permission denied.
jag vet att jag har rätt anv.namn och lösenord.
får någonting med att PAM_USER_ACCOUNT does not exist.
har provat att avaktivera PAM i sshd_config men det hjälper inte.
funkade bra i 10.04. har de ändrat något i 12.04:an ??
/ Simon
Re: får permission denied när jag ska logga in via ssh
Postat: 01 maj 2012, 16:46
av zimzon
detta får jag när jag försöker logga in (ssh -v (serverip)
Kod: Markera allt
simon@simon-Aspire-5738 ~ $ ssh -v [user]@192.168.1.65
OpenSSH_5.8p1 Debian-7ubuntu1, OpenSSL 1.0.0e 6 Sep 2011
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: Applying options for *
debug1: Connecting to 192.168.1.65 [192.168.1.65] port 22.
debug1: Connection established.
debug1: identity file /home/simon/.ssh/id_rsa type -1
debug1: identity file /home/simon/.ssh/id_rsa-cert type -1
debug1: identity file /home/simon/.ssh/id_dsa type -1
debug1: identity file /home/simon/.ssh/id_dsa-cert type -1
debug1: identity file /home/simon/.ssh/id_ecdsa type -1
debug1: identity file /home/simon/.ssh/id_ecdsa-cert type -1
debug1: Remote protocol version 2.0, remote software version OpenSSH_5.9p1 Debian-5ubuntu1
debug1: match: OpenSSH_5.9p1 Debian-5ubuntu1 pat OpenSSH*
debug1: Enabling compatibility mode for protocol 2.0
debug1: Local version string SSH-2.0-OpenSSH_5.8p1 Debian-7ubuntu1
debug1: SSH2_MSG_KEXINIT sent
debug1: SSH2_MSG_KEXINIT received
debug1: kex: server->client aes128-ctr hmac-md5 none
debug1: kex: client->server aes128-ctr hmac-md5 none
debug1: sending SSH2_MSG_KEX_ECDH_INIT
debug1: expecting SSH2_MSG_KEX_ECDH_REPLY
debug1: Server host key: ECDSA 27:e8:5a:b5:46:30:47:e9:2b:f6:4b:34:a1:36:41:31
debug1: Host '192.168.1.65' is known and matches the ECDSA host key.
debug1: Found key in /home/simon/.ssh/known_hosts:1
debug1: ssh_ecdsa_verify: signature correct
debug1: SSH2_MSG_NEWKEYS sent
debug1: expecting SSH2_MSG_NEWKEYS
debug1: SSH2_MSG_NEWKEYS received
debug1: Roaming not allowed by [user]
debug1: SSH2_MSG_SERVICE_REQUEST sent
debug1: SSH2_MSG_SERVICE_ACCEPT received
debug1: Authentications that can continue: publickey,password
debug1: Next authentication method: publickey
debug1: Trying private key: /home/simon/.ssh/id_rsa
debug1: Trying private key: /home/simon/.ssh/id_dsa
debug1: Trying private key: /home/simon/.ssh/id_ecdsa
debug1: Next authentication method: password
[user]@192.168.1.65's password:
debug1: Authentications that can continue: publickey,password
Permission denied, please try again.
[user]@192.168.1.65's password:
debug1: Authentications that can continue: publickey,password
Permission denied, please try again.
[user]@192.168.1.65's password:
Re: får permission denied när jag ska logga in via ssh
Postat: 01 maj 2012, 21:19
av johanre
Vad står i /var/log/auth.log på servern vid tidpunkten för dina inloggningsförsök?
Re: får permission denied när jag ska logga in via ssh
Postat: 02 maj 2012, 16:59
av zimzon
Kod: Markera allt
May 2 16:54:55 matrixhub sshd[1717]: pam_unix(sshd:auth): authentication failure;
logname= uid=0 euid=0 tty=ssh ruser= rhost=simon-aspire-5738.lan user=******
May 2 16:54:55 matrixhub sshd[1717]: pam_winbind(sshd:auth): getting password (0x00000388)
May 2 16:54:55 matrixhub sshd[1717]: pam_winbind(sshd:auth): pam_get_item returned a password
May 2 16:54:55 matrixhub sshd[1717]: pam_winbind(sshd:auth): request wbcLogonUser
failed: WBC_ERR_AUTH_ERROR, PAM error: PAM_USER_UNKNOWN (10),
NTSTATUS: NT_STATUS_NO_SUCH_USER, Error message was: No such user
May 2 16:54:57 matrixhub sshd[1717]: Failed password for ****** from 192.168.1.109 port
37918 ssh2
May 2 16:54:59 matrixhub sshd[1717]: Connection closed by 192.168.1.109 [preauth]
har strukit username med *****. vill gärna inte visa vilket username jag har

Re: får permission denied när jag ska logga in via ssh
Postat: 02 maj 2012, 18:28
av webaake
Har du filen /etc/pam.d/sshd ? Hur ser den ut? Jag kan logga in fint på 12.04 med UsePAM yes i sshd_config.
Re: får permission denied när jag ska logga in via ssh
Postat: 02 maj 2012, 19:37
av zimzon
ok. jag installerade om 12.04:an och det fungerar nu.
det måste ha blivit fel under installationen (trorligtvis jag för tux har aldrig fel hehe )
tack för all hjälp ändå!
Re: får permission denied när jag ska logga in via ssh
Postat: 02 maj 2012, 21:01
av webaake
Vad lärde vi av det? Ingenting.
Re: får permission denied när jag ska logga in via ssh
Postat: 03 maj 2012, 21:18
av johanre
Du hade winbind (förmodligen via samba) installerat och dina inloggningsförsök gick till samba snarare än direkt till de användare som finns listade i /etc/passwd.
Re: får permission denied när jag ska logga in via ssh
Postat: 03 maj 2012, 21:33
av webaake
Tack för det!
På min uppgradering till 12.04 bytte nätverkskorten namn och samba slutade fungera. Lätt fixat i /etc/samba/smb.conf.
Man lär sig.